[Appearance]
Helmition’s are often confused with inanimate knight helmets, because they appear just as that; empty helmets that’ve been separated from the full suit of armor. It was contested until recently whether or not this pokemon was real, but the few appearances of this rare species have provided proof of the species’ existence. The ghost-type take the form of these vacant helms, primarily black in color, with gold trimmings highlighting the faceplate which wrap around the back. A long slit that would normally be used to see through separates the two segments of the stationary faceplate, and from underneath the top of the plate a short, black, metal spike extends out away from the helmet, somewhat resembling the horn on a Charmeleon. The spirits take the form of their ancient armor, which warped and changed into the forms we see today.

The shiny variants of these pokemon trade their onyx and gold for a brighter color palette, replacing the black with an orange color while the gold becomes a navy blue. There are no gender differences at this stage in evolution.

Pokedex Entry:

Helmition; The Lost Spirit Pokemon. While it was questioned for some time whether or not these pokemon were their own species, recent studies have now confirmed this extremely rare pokemon’s existence. It takes quite some time for the spirits to finally manifest enough energy to move, hence why they are now a relatively new discovery. They are capable of speech, but only through telepathy, as much of the power they have is spent maintaining their form.

[Diet]

As this pokemon lacks any means of consuming food like most pokemon, Helmitions instead feed upon the energies of the people around them. In the pokemon’s first stage of evolution, the spirit lacks the energy to manifest as more pieces of the armor, and whatever human presence it used to be is absent. Thus, it feeds off the life force of the living, consuming their energy in order to grow stronger. It typically does this simply by drawing off the excess that radiates from all living things, sucking what it can into itself like a vortex. However, the drain is minimal at best when it can only feed from what is being naturally put out.

With that in mind, all trainers who find themselves in possession of this pokemon are warned to never place a Helmition on their head. If the pokemon is placed on a human head(or a pokemon’s, if it can fit around it) then it can draw directly from the trainer themselves, draining them of whatever energy it can from them. This can and often will prove fatal, unless someone else can quickly remove it, as the feeding will paralyze the person they are draining off of.

[Behavior]

As they are often found in more remote areas, Helmitions often remain inactive until a human presence, or something comparable, lingers in the area long enough for it to feed sufficiently. Once it has the strength to move again, it will often seek out and attempt to stay near the source, until it has fed on them and those surrounding them enough to evolve. As it only has the helmet to work with however, it is restricted to very limited movement, rolling around or even hopping until it has at least enough power to hover extremely low to the ground. It cannot get any higher than a few inches though, at most, so it cannot simply hover up and attach itself to someone’s head.

[Habitat]

Often found inert in places such as old castles, ancient battlefields, and aged ruins, these empty shells are inhabited by long dead warriors whose spirits lingered, unable to pass on. It is uncommon for them to venture far from where they were laid to rest without a human, seeing that they lack sufficient energy to travel alone for an extended period of time. However, there are rare reports of them appearing in small, populated areas, which have been built over grave sites and other locations where warriors met their end. Some can also be found in the possession of merchants and collectors who mistake them for antiques.

[Appearance]
While the species requires a large amount of spiritual energy to manifest the different portions of their body, they require significantly less to maintain those forms. Thus, after feeding on sufficient amounts spirit energy, a Helmition is able to make use of more segments of armor, evolving into Revlete as it expands to cover most of the upper torso of their old armor. The helmet is still disconnected from the breastplate, and while the armor does sport shoulder pads, the arms do not start until the elbow pad, a strong weave of leather-covered chainmail connecting it to the plate glove, forming a disconnected gauntlet. The same chain weave extends down from the breastplate, cutting off in tatters midway to the waist, marking the end of this pokemon’s abilities before the final evolution. The color scheme stays largely the same; a deep, almost charred black plate armor with gold trimmings to highlight the shape, however the additional chain weave is covered by hardened brown leather.

Shiny variants also retain their color palette, the plate turning orange instead of black, with navy blue trimmings. The treated leather takes on a more silvery, whitish color instead, however. While not very pronounced at this stage, the gender differences do begin to appear at this point. Female Revletes have thinner, slightly more feminine forms, but largely remain only marginally less bulky than the males.

Pokedex Entry:
Revlete; The Lost Spirit Pokemon. After evolving into a more complete form, the Revlete has consumed enough energy to maintain their form much easier. They still require more to evolve, but by this point they have more than enough to simply maintain their shape. Due to the fact that they have more power stored within them, and do not require as much to maintain their shape, they will often have brief flashes of memories from their past lives. They are capable of speech, both through telepathy and through vocalizations from behind the helmet.

[Diet]
The diet for this form deviates a bit from the previous evolution. While it consumes marginally less energy, now that it’s developed a little more, this stage in evolution also tends to narrow its tastes down to strictly humans. Where Helmitions would primarily feed off of people due to their output, they wouldn’t stop themselves from drawing what they could from other pokemon, Revletes on the other hand often chose to limit themselves to only the spirits of humans. Their form is the most familiar to them, and since they have such a high excess of energy, they often find it best to feed off of the creatures they prefer most.

Though there are still risks involved, a trainer is capable of entering the armor at this stage of evolution. Immediately upon evolving, the spirit may still automatically drain anyone who enters it, but after a short time passes, it will have adjusted to have proper control over its feeding. Trainers who have worn Revletes for extended periods of time, however, do report growing fatigued faster than usual, so trainers are advised not to make a habit of wearing them.

[Behavior]
At this stage in evolution, Revletes will almost always be found with or near humans, with those who aren’t actively seeking out a person to gravitate towards. Wishing to finally finish their growth and become whole, they will remain with a trainer in order to draw from their spirit, and as they absorb more and more, their personalities will be largely influenced by the person they feed off of. These can be minor mannerisms or major traits, but as more and more of the ghost-type’s consciousness forms, those influences can shape what they become.

[Appearance]
Finally having gathered enough energy to fully manifest itself, the Cavantasm is able to completely manifest as the suit of armor it once wore in life. Typically, their charred armor remains largely the same as in their previous forms; onyx black metal with gold accents, leather-covered chainmail proving just as sturdy as the rest as the rest of their body, and now complete with a waist-guard and a set of greaves, the only completely new addition being a blazing red cloth that wraps around the neck and shoulder area, the length of which varies anywhere from a full cloak to a simple scarf.

The shiny coloration remains the same as in the previous evolutions, however the cape takes on a gold color, with an ancient, tribalistic symbol of the sun emblazoned on the back. A lost symbol of a forgotten kingdom, no doubt. The gender differences are still only minor, but a bit more apparent in this final form, female Cavantasms taking on a sleeker and thinner frame, despite the bulk of their armor. The cloth of the females almost always come in the form of the long, trailing scarves.

[Sprite]
User ImageUser Image

Pokedex Entry:
Cavantasm; The Forgotten Warrior Pokemon. Now having attained all the power it needs to reform the armor completely and sustain itself, the ghost-type no longer requires a steady stream of spiritual energy. At this stage, the pokemon’s memories from before their death can return, often influencing their behavior and sometimes causing drastic personality shifts. The spirit still continues to slowly feed on the energy around it, however, passively absorbing power, though it cannot enhance itself any further. It uses this power to manifest a weapon in combat, temporarily making the spiritual construct corporeal to strike an opponent before it fades away. They are capable of speech, both through telepathy and through vocalizations from behind the helmet.

[Diet]
Now fully developed, this stage in evolution no longer requires a constant flow of spiritual energy. Because it's now manifested all of the armor it once wore, it can sustain itself by subsiding off of residual energy in the world around it, unlikely to feed consciously on any one thing. Because of this, it is possible for a trainer to go inside the armor safely, as long as the spirit ultimately isn’t aggressive towards them.

[Behavior]
In most cases, the spirit in this phase of evolution has fully regained its former memories, which can cause a shift in the being’s personality and habits. This can range anywhere from an entire reversal in behavior, a mild blend of what once was and what’s become of them, to even no noticeable changes. However, by now, the new personality will often become dominant, and will typically assimilate the older one entirely. This is not always the case, though, so trainers are advised to remain cautious if they happen to evolve this pokemon.

[Habitat]

Cannot be found naturally in the wild, due to requiring a human to reliably feed off of to reach this stage in evolution.
